DUDDINGTON WAR MEMORIAL

World War 1 & 2 - Roll of Honour with detailed information
Compiled and copyright © 2004 Ernie Rusdale

1914-1918

CHEESE

William Gerard

Chaplain 4th Class, Army Chaplains’ Department, attached 8th Lincolnshire Regiment. Died 07-11-18. Brother of Miss B. F. Cheese, ‘Roslin’, White Knole Road, Buxton. Buried in St. Sever Cemetery Extension, Rouen, Grave S.V.G.06.

JACKSON

Nicholas William Goddard

2nd Lieutenant, 1st Northamptonshire Regiment. Killed in action 09-09-16, aged 20. Son of Nicholas Goddard Jackson and Jessie Jackson, Duddington, Northants. Educated at Harrow and Trinity College, Cambridge. Buried in Caterpillar Valley Cemetery, Longueval, Grave XII.F.39.

PAYNE

Ernest

Private, 241983, Ernest William Payne, 5th Border Regiment. Killed in action 23-04-17, aged 33. Born and resident Duddington, enlisted Peterborough. Son of Philip and Harriet Payne, Duddington, Northants. Commemorated on Arras Memorial, Bay 06.

WALKER

Edgar

Private, 3/9454, 2nd Northamptonshire Regiment. Died of wounds 14-03-15, aged 21. Born Thistleton, Rutland, enlisted Peterborough. Son of William and Elizabeth Walker, Dadlington Lodge, Dadlington, Nuneaton, Warwickshire. Connection with Duddington unclear. Buried in Boulogne Eastern Cemetery, Grave III.D.15.

WALKER

Herbert

Private, 10th Cheshire Regiment. Believed to be: Private, 50642, 10th Cheshire Regiment. Killed in action 12-08-17. Formerly 30136, Leicestershire Regiment. Born Sheepy Magna, enlisted Atherstone, Warwick. Connection with Duddington unclear. Commemorated on Menin Gate Memorial, Panels 19/22.

WALKER

William

Private, 12239, 8th Lincolnshire Regiment. Killed in action 26-09-15. Born Thistleton, Rutland, enlisted Grantham, resident Nuneaton, Warwickshire. Connection with Duddington unclear. Commemorated on Loos Memorial, Panels 31/34.

1939-1945

THODAY

George Henry

Sergeant, 4803669, 6th Lincolnshire Regiment. Killed in action North Africa 28-02-1943, aged 24. Son of George Gerald and Elizabeth Ann Thoday, Duddington, Northants. Commemorated on Medjez-El-Bab Memorial, Tunisia, Panel 16.
